Mobility Scooters: A Comprehensive Guide
Mobility scooters have ended up being a necessary mode of transportation for lots of individuals facing mobility difficulties. This article explores the various aspects of mobility scooters, including their types, benefits, features, and a guide for prospective purchasers.
Comprehending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ters are electrically powered devices created for individuals with restricted mobility. They provide a means of transportation for individuals who might have difficulty strolling but still want to keep their self-reliance. They can be found in different styles and functions to cater to a broad range of requirements.
Types of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ters can normally be categorized into 3 main types:
TypeDescriptionBest ForCompact ScootersThese are small and lightweight, perfect for indoors and short trips.Users with restricted storage area or those who take a trip typically.Mid-size ScootersA balance between mobility and stability, ideal for both indoor and outdoor use.Those who need to cover a variety of terrains.Heavy-duty ScootersLarge and robust, designed for rugged outside usage and heavier people.Users requiring extra weight capacity or going off-road.Key Features of Mobility Scooters
The choice of mobility scooter typically depends upon the features that align with private needs. Here are some of the crucial features to think about:

Weight Capacity: Mobility scooters feature different weight limits. It is important to choose a scooter that can properly support the user's weight.

Variety: The range a scooter can travel on a single charge differs. Depending upon user requirements, one might select scooters with a series of as much as 40 miles.

Speed: Most mobility scooters can reach speeds between 4 to 8 mph. Consider what speed is comfy and safe for the desired environment.

Turning Radius: A compact turning radius is important for indoor use, allowing for simpler navigation in tight spaces.

Battery Type: The type of batteries used can affect the scooter's efficiency. Lead-acid and lithium-ion batteries are the most typical.
Advantages of Using Mobility Scooters
The benefits of mobility scooters extend beyond just transportation. Some essential benefits include:

Independence: Users can browse their environment without depending on caregivers, promoting self-reliance and self-confidence.

Health Benefits: Using a scooter can motivate outdoor activity, resulting in physical and mental health enhancements by lowering sensations of seclusion.

Convenience: Scooters can quickly be run in numerous environments, whether inside, in shopping malls, or outdoors.
Essential Considerations When Buying a Mobility Scooter
When buying a mobility scooter, numerous considerations can help ensure that you select the ideal model:

Assess Individual Needs:
Mobility level: Consider just how much assistance the individual will need.Variety of use: Determine where the scooter will mostly be utilized (indoors, outdoors, on rough terrains, etc).
Test Drive:
Always test drive several models to discover an ideal fit. Take notice of comfort, ease of steering, and the scooter's responsiveness.
Evaluation Safety Features:
Look for scooters with sufficient safety features like lights, indicators, and anti-tip designs.
Examine Warranty and Service Options:
A trusted guarantee and offered service choices are vital for long-lasting use.Frequently Asked Questions about Mobility Scooters
1. How quickly do mobility scooters go?Mobility scooters typically have speeds ranging from 4 to 8 miles per hour, with many created for safety instead of high-speed travel. 2. Are there weight limitations on mobility scooters?Yes, mobility
scooters come with particular weight limitations, frequently varying from
250 lbs to over 500 pounds, depending upon the design. 3. Can mobility scooters be utilized indoors?Certain designs, especially compact scooters, are specifically designed for
indoor usage and are easier to maneuver in tight spaces. 4. How typically do the batteries need to be replaced?Battery life can vary based on usage, but typically, with correct care, batteries may last between 1 to 3 years before requiring replacement
. 5.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?Coverage can differ, however some insurance coverage plans, including Medicare and Medicaid, might cover part of the expense. It's suggested to contact specific insurance coverage providers. Mobility scooters serve as a
